Control Module: Service and Repair






Transmission Control Module J217, Replacing

To achieve optimal anti-theft protection for the vehicle, an anti-theft immobilizer was installed. The anti-theft immobilizer is a system for enabling/locking the Transmission Control Module (TCM) (J217).

Procedure

Check the identification of the previous Transmission Control Module (TCM) (J217) as follows:

- Connect the scan tool.

- Switch the ignition on.

- Select "Diagnostic mode 9 - Vehicle Information."

- Select the"Calibration identification".

- The Transmission Control Module (TCM) (J217) identification will be displayed.

- End diagnosis and switch the ignition off.

Removal

- Remove the left front wheel housing liner.

- Disconnect the Transmission Control Module (TCM) (J217) electrical harness connector.

- Remove the Transmission Control Module (TCM) (J217). - arrow -





Installation

- Installation is performed in the reverse order of removal. note the following:

- Check the identification of the new Transmission Control Module (TCM) (J217) to ensure it matches the old Transmission Control Module (TCM) (J217).

- Code the Transmission Control Module (TCM) (J217).

- Erase the DTC memory. Refer to => [ Diagnostic Mode 04 - Erase DTC Memory ] Diagnostic Mode 04 - Erase DTC Memory.

- Perform a road test to verify repair.

If the DTC does not return:

Repair complete, Generate readiness code. Refer to => [ Readiness Code ] Readiness Code.

End of Procedure
